i'm working on doing a swap into a lt1 bird. looking at a complete 03 lq9, which i understand has the short crank (p/n: 12552216) how does this one compare to the stock ls1 crank?

my plan was to get the motor in and running first, then build a l92 top end for it, just rather not have the car sitting there collecting dust while its nice out.

They are heaver, There not lightened like the LS1's are , witch are drilled thew the journals, aka (gun drilled)

the lq series cranks will take whatever you can throw at them. they are just as durable if not moreso than an ls1 crank.
